Ind. Code § 20-50-3-3

"School of origin"

As added by P.L.133-2008, SEC.3.

Sec. 3. As used in this chapter, "school of origin" means the school:

(1) that a student in foster care attended when the student last had a permanent residence; or

(2) in which a student in foster care was last enrolled.
